.two-col-form{background:linear-gradient(180deg,#f9fafb,rgba(249,250,251,0))}.two-col-form .content-box{background:#fff;border-radius:16px;margin:0 auto;max-width:1140px}.two-col-form .box{display:flex}.two-col-form .box:first-child{padding-left:0}.two-col-form .main-box{background-position:50%;background-repeat:no-repeat;background-size:cover;border-radius:16px;height:100%;overflow:hidden;padding:60px 40px;position:relative;width:100%}.two-col-form .main-box h2{color:#fff;font-size:48px;font-weight:600;line-height:1.2;margin-bottom:28px;position:relative;z-index:1}.two-col-form .main-box p{color:#fff;font-size:18px;font-weight:400;line-height:1.5;margin:0;position:relative;z-index:1}.two-col-form .form-box{padding:45px 50px;width:100%}.two-col-form .form-box .hsfc-Step__Content{padding:0!important}.two-col-form .form-box form .hsfc-FieldLabel{color:#7072f7;font-family:Poppins,sans-serif;font-size:14px;font-weight:500;margin-bottom:13px}.two-col-form .form-box form .hsfc-FieldLabel .hsfc-FieldLabel__RequiredIndicator{display:none}.two-col-form .form-box form .hsfc-Row{margin-bottom:24px}.two-col-form .form-box form input,.two-col-form .form-box form select,.two-col-form .form-box textarea{background:transparent;border:1px solid #d1d5db;border-radius:6px;box-shadow:none!important;color:#111827;font-family:Poppins,sans-serif;font-size:14px;font-weight:400;outline:0;padding:14px 10px;width:100%!important}.two-col-form .form-box form .hsfc-PhoneInput__FlagAndCaret{background:transparent;border:1px solid #d1d5db;color:#111827;padding:10px}.two-col-form .form-box textarea{min-height:92px;resize:none}.two-col-form .form-box form input::placeholder,.two-col-form .form-box form select::placeholder,.two-col-form .form-box textarea::placeholder{color:#b3b7be}.two-col-form .form-box .hsfc-NavigationRow{margin:0}.two-col-form .form-box .hsfc-NavigationRow .hsfc-NavigationRow__Buttons button{background:#7072f7;border-radius:6px;color:#fff;cursor:pointer;font-family:Poppins,sans-serif;font-size:16px;font-weight:500;padding:15px 16px;transform:translateY(0)!important;width:100%}.two-col-form .form-box form .hsfc-ErrorAlert{color:#ff0000ba;font-family:Poppins,sans-serif;font-size:14px;font-weight:400}.two-col-form .form-box .hsfc-RichText p{margin-bottom:10px}@media(max-width:991.98px){.two-col-form .box:first-child{padding-left:0;padding-right:0}.two-col-form .form-box{padding:45px 30px}}@media(max-width:767.98px){.two-col-form .main-box{padding:30px 15px}.two-col-form .main-box h2{font-size:30px}.two-col-form .main-box p{font-size:16px}.two-col-form .form-box{padding:32px 3px 0}}